How the Interface Enhances Gameplay
One of the biggest hurdles in online board games is replicating the tactile satisfaction players get from physical pieces and a tangible board. Monopoly Live tackles this by integrating smooth animations and clear visual cues that guide players intuitively through each turn. Color-coded properties, animated dice rolls, and a live host element add a dynamic layer that keeps gameplay fresh.
The developers have also incorporated elements from popular live game shows, which adds a social energy absent in many digital board games. This fusion creates an engaging atmosphere where players can anticipate every move with genuine excitement.

Balancing Fun and Responsibility
While the allure of monopoly live lies in its entertaining format, it’s important to approach the game with a responsible mindset. Like many online games that involve wagering, it’s wise to set personal limits and avoid chasing losses. The game is meant to be an enjoyable diversion rather than a source of stress.
